Is it OK to connect NC pins of CY8C5488FNI-LP212 to GND?
Could you please let us know about NC pins connection inside IC?
Is it floating? Is it connected to GND? Or is it connected to other pins?

NC stands for "No Connect" which means that the pin is not internally connected to the die.
So it can be either left floating or tied to GND or tied to VCC.
It seems that the terminals that should not be connected in Cypress are expressed as "DNU".
